ChatDBA – AI Database Assistant, providing quick diagnosis of database faults through descriptions or screenshots.
What is ChatDBA?
ChatDBA is an intelligent database assistant based on large AI language models. It can quickly diagnose database faults, analyze root causes, and provide solutions, significantly improving the work efficiency of Database Administrators (DBAs). ChatDBA features SQL generation and optimization capabilities, enabling it to generate efficient SQL statements based on user needs and optimize the performance of existing SQL queries, helping developers enhance their development efficiency. It also supports learning database-related professional knowledge, continuously updating its knowledge base to provide users with ongoing professional support. ChatDBA supports various database types, including MySQL, PostgreSQL, and OceanBase. Users can try it for free on the official website.
The main functions of ChatDBA
- Database Fault Diagnosis: ChatDBA can quickly analyze the root cause of database faults based on text descriptions, error screenshots, monitoring information, etc., provided by users, and offer targeted solutions. This saves Database Administrators’ (DBA) time in troubleshooting and improves work efficiency.
- SQL Generation: Based on users’ requirement descriptions, ChatDBA can automatically generate SQL statements that meet the requirements, helping developers quickly complete database operation development tasks.
- SQL Optimization: Perform performance analysis and optimization on existing SQL statements, adjust query logic, index usage, etc., to improve query efficiency and reduce database resource consumption.
- Database Performance Analysis: ChatDBA can analyze the overall performance of the database, including query performance and resource usage. It can provide diagnostic reports on performance bottlenecks and give optimization suggestions to help users improve the overall running efficiency of the database.
- Database Knowledge Q&A: ChatDBA has a rich database knowledge base and can answer users’ questions about database principles, architecture design, operation and maintenance management, etc. It can provide learning materials and suggestions according to users’ needs to help users improve their database-related knowledge level.
- Multi-database Support: ChatDBA supports multiple mainstream databases, such as MySQL, PostgreSQL, and OceanBase, meeting the usage needs of different users in different database environments.
- Intelligent Interaction Experience: Through natural language interaction, users can directly describe problems in words, and ChatDBA provides solutions or operation suggestions in the form of a conversation, making the interaction process simple and intuitive.
The official website address of ChatDBA
- Official website address: chatdba.com
Application scenarios of ChatDBA
- Database Operation and Maintenance: In database operation and maintenance, ChatDBA can help DBAs quickly locate and solve complex problems.
- Small and Medium-sized Enterprises: For small and medium-sized enterprises, ChatDBA helps them achieve efficient database management and optimization at a lower cost.
- Knowledge Learning and Training: ChatDBA can serve as a tool for learning database knowledge, helping novice DBAs and developers quickly improve their professional skills.
- Emergency Response: In emergencies, such as system failures or data loss, ChatDBA can quickly provide solutions to help technicians restore the system promptly.